Independent learning 

We are focusing on independent learning across the setting. It would therefore be great if you could follow this up at home in your own way. Things we will be encouraging at preschool :-

  • Putting on coats and aprons and putting them away in the right place
  • Self selecting resources: looking for the things/tools they need for their task
  • Tidy up time. Helping to put away the things they have played with or that they have used at snack time.
  • Thinking creatively and critically when making things with various tools and materials, again looking for and finding where things are
  • Asking questions and using language to explain and describe.

Easter biscuits

These delicious little biscuits make a great alternative to chocolate at Easter time.

100g butter

100g caster sugar

Half a lemon rind and juice

Half a teaspoon of mixed spice

200g plain flour

50g currants

1tbsp caster sugar

  1. Cream together the butter and sugar until light and fluffy.
  2. Beat in the lemon rind and juice, mixed spice and egg yolk.
  3. Add the flour and currants and mix into a stiff dough.
  4. Roll out dough on a floured surface until 5mm/¼” thick.
  5. Cut into circles or shapes and place these on an oiled baking tray.
  6. Gather together the off cuts and re roll to make further biscuits.
  7. Bake in a pre heated oven for 10/12 minutes.
  8. Carefully remove the biscuits and brush with egg white.
  9. Using fingers sprinkle the spoonful of sugar over the tops of the biscuits.
  10. Return the biscuits to the oven for a further 3/5 minutes.

Temperature & cooking time:
Oven 200°C/Fan180C/400°F/Gas 6 for10/12 minutes then 3/5 minutes
